Understanding Rare Earth Metals

Rare earth metals are a group of 17 elements, including lanthanides and two additional elements, scandium and yttrium. These metals possess unique properties that make them indispensable in various high-tech applications, notably in the manufacture of lithium-ion batteries. Ingredients like neodymium, dysprosium, and lanthanum contribute to the efficiency and energy density of batteries, unlocking potential that outstrips conventional materials.

Market Trends and Future Prospects

The demand for lithium-ion batteries, and consequently for rare earth metals, is projected to surge, driven by the global shift toward electric and hybrid vehicles. Furthermore, the push for cleaner energy sources is propelling innovations in battery technology.

Companies are increasingly investing in research and development to harness the unique properties of rare earth metals to create more efficient, sustainable, and powerful batteries. Emerging technologies such as solid-state batteries indicate that the future of energy storage is bright, but it will heavily rely on the availability of rare earth elements.
